Mother, wife and author, Terneisha Amun, holds an Associate degree in Criminal Justice and previously worked as a student aide at the Primary school level, but her unwavering passion for promoting cultural education, “one book at a time”, resulted in the launch of her first book, The Calypso Baby.
The book, she said, is a means of enabling local and international audiences of any age to learn about Calypso at both casual and academic levels.
Amun’s pen name is Te’Amun, and The Calypso Baby, this, part one—A Visit to My Grandparents – features 100 calypsonians.
“I penned this book primarily based on the evident need to create a fun and interactive avenue not only for Trinidadian children, but also the world at large to experience and partake of our sweet kaiso music, and through their desire to publish more cultural education content, the Brower Park Library in Brooklyn New York describes it as ‘a seed planted to seek out and listen to some of the famous calypsonians that are referenced in the story and activities’.”
Amun further stated that it’s not only her burning desire that fueled the ultimate product but her three-year-old son, Akihmien Amun, who admirably showed a natural propensity to calypso and music. “I wanted to introduce him to calypso from a very young age, and he absolutely loves it. He particularly loves the music of Ras Shorty I, David Rudder, Black Stalin and Drupatee.”
The Calypso Baby (Part One) entails fun activities for the entire family embracing Word Search, Crossword, and Comprehension, among other areas.
Te’Amun also explained that her grandmother’s upbringing properly positioned her to be a wholesome woman—to be kind, humble, generous and have a strong relationship with God. “It was during my childhood and seeing my grandmother’s love for Calypso music that gave me the motivation to promote cultural education via the launch of my first book: The Calypso Baby.”
